What does a 'zero of a function' represent on a graph?

Where the graph crosses the y-axis

The highest or lowest point of the graph

Where the graph crosses the x-axis

The slope of the graph

What happens to the graph of a polynomial function at an x-intercept if its corresponding factor has an odd multiplicity?

The graph bounces off the x-axis

The graph goes through the x-axis

The graph approaches infinity

The graph has a horizontal asymptote

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

How does the graph of a polynomial function behave at an x-intercept if its corresponding factor has an even multiplicity?

The graph goes through the x-axis

The graph bounces off the x-axis

The graph becomes a straight line

The graph has a vertical asymptote
